Washington Post Compares Victoria Newman to Rupert Murdoch?!
By Jamey Giddens on July 22, 2011


Okay, this is awesomeness. A blogger for the Washington Post referenced a storyline from CBS Daytime's The Young and the Restless in a piece about the News Corp. phone hacking scandal! When discussing allegations that British tabloids like Rupert Murdoch's now defunct and disgraced News of The World made practice of bribing elected officials, Genoa City's own Victoria Newman (Amelia Heinle) was cited.

A partial nod must go to the soap opera The Young and the Restless, whose character Victoria Newman was arrested on her wedding day for allegedly bribing a foreign dignitary. Television and Murdoch and ’round-the-clock FCPA conjecture — it’s a welcome publicity storm for the FCPA bar.
